## Deploying the Gatewick Proctor Queue

Deploys are pretty painless: push to main, wait for the pipeline, then watch the queue drain dashboard for five minutes. If candidates pile up mid-exam, roll back first and ask questions later — the queue replays safely. Everything the workers care about lives in one config block, shown here for reference.

settings of bafof-yagef:
JOROX_PIN=8740
JOROX_TENANT=pelox
JOROX_METRICS_HOST=metrics.jorox.qorvelworks.internal
JOROX_SEAL=seal_c78f63c1
JOROX_STANDBY_TEAM=norax

**Q: Does Fernlock support hot-reloading of plugin configuration?**

Yes. Edit your plugin's config file and Fernlock picks up changes within five seconds. No restart needed. Exceptions: port bindings and auth mode require a full restart. Schema violations are rejected and the previous config stays active — check the reload log for errors. Reload events fire the onConfigReload hook, so register a handler if your plugin caches settings. To enable hot-reload on a locked sandbox instance, enter the recovery passphrase below.

recovery phrase for fajep-yaweg: gilath-sorox-wenius-rusdor-keliel-zorius

Canary gating for Veldane plugins: your build must hold error rates below the baseline cohort for two full evaluation windows before the gate advances traffic past 5%. Do not retry a failed gate manually; the Lanthorn controller records the rejection and requires a fresh submission. When filing a gate dispute, include the token shown beneath this paragraph.

trace token, fafog-kageg: htk4_98e6

## Further Reading

The Hollowpine component library follows strict semantic versioning, and every minor release is accompanied by a signed changelog reviewed by the platform team. For security review purposes, note that patch releases may still introduce new transitive dependencies, so audit the lockfile diff rather than the version number alone. Deprecated components remain installable for two major versions but receive no security fixes. The dependency audit log and signing policy are published on the internal page here.

wiki page, tahaf-tajog: https://jira.ordindyn.corp/pipeline